| namespace syncer { |
| |
| class SyncDataLocal; |
| class SyncDataRemote; |
| |
| // A light-weight container for immutable sync data. Pass-by-value and storage |
| // in STL containers are supported and encouraged if helpful. |
| class SyncData { |
| public: |
| // Creates an empty and invalid SyncData. |
| SyncData(); |
| SyncData(const SyncData& other); |
| ~SyncData(); |
| |
| // Default copy and assign welcome. |
| |
| // Helper methods for creating SyncData objects for local data. |
| // |
| // |sync_tag| Must be a string unique to this datatype and is used as a node |
| // identifier server-side. |
| // |
| // For deletes: |datatype| must specify the datatype who node is being |
| // deleted. |
| // |
| // For adds/updates: |specifics| must be valid and |non_unique_title| (can be |
| // the same as |sync_tag|) must be specfied. Note: |non_unique_title| is |
| // primarily for debug purposes, and will be overwritten if the datatype is |
| // encrypted. |
| static SyncData CreateLocalDelete(const std::string& sync_tag, |
| ModelType datatype); |
| static SyncData CreateLocalData(const std::string& sync_tag, |
| const std::string& non_unique_title, |
| const sync_pb::EntitySpecifics& specifics); |
| |
| // Helper method for creating SyncData objects originating from the syncer. |
| static SyncData CreateRemoteData(int64_t id, |
| sync_pb::EntitySpecifics specifics, |
| std::string client_tag_hash = std::string()); |
| |
| // Whether this SyncData holds valid data. The only way to have a SyncData |
| // without valid data is to use the default constructor. |
| bool IsValid() const; |
| |
| // Return the datatype we're holding information about. Derived from the sync |
| // datatype specifics. |
| ModelType GetDataType() const; |
| |
| // Return the current sync datatype specifics. |
| const sync_pb::EntitySpecifics& GetSpecifics() const; |
| |
| // Return the non unique title (for debugging). Currently only set for data |
| // going TO the syncer, not from. |
| const std::string& GetTitle() const; |
| |
| // Whether this sync data is for local data or data coming from the syncer. |
| bool IsLocal() const; |
| |
| std::string ToString() const; |
| |
| // TODO(zea): Query methods for other sync properties: parent, successor, etc. |
| |
| protected: |
| // These data members are protected so derived types like SyncDataLocal and |
| // SyncDataRemote can access them. |
| |
| // Necessary since we forward-declare sync_pb::SyncEntity; see |
| // comments in immutable.h. |
| struct ImmutableSyncEntityTraits { |
| using Wrapper = sync_pb::SyncEntity*; |
| |
| static void InitializeWrapper(Wrapper* wrapper); |
| |
| static void DestroyWrapper(Wrapper* wrapper); |
| |
| static const sync_pb::SyncEntity& Unwrap(const Wrapper& wrapper); |
| |
| static sync_pb::SyncEntity* UnwrapMutable(Wrapper* wrapper); |
| |
| static void Swap(sync_pb::SyncEntity* t1, sync_pb::SyncEntity* t2); |
| }; |
| |
| using ImmutableSyncEntity = |
| Immutable<sync_pb::SyncEntity, ImmutableSyncEntityTraits>; |
| |
| int64_t id_; |
| |
| // The actual shared sync entity being held. |
| ImmutableSyncEntity immutable_entity_; |
| |
| private: |
| // Whether this SyncData represents a local change. |
| bool is_local_; |
| |
| // Whether this SyncData holds valid data. |
| bool is_valid_; |
| |
| // Clears |entity|. |
| SyncData(bool is_local_, int64_t id, sync_pb::SyncEntity* entity); |
| }; |
| |
| // A SyncData going to the syncer. |
| class SyncDataLocal : public SyncData { |
| public: |
| // Construct a SyncDataLocal from a SyncData. |
| // |
| // |sync_data|'s IsLocal() must be true. |
| explicit SyncDataLocal(const SyncData& sync_data); |
| ~SyncDataLocal(); |
| |
| // Return the value of the unique client tag. This is only set for data going |
| // TO the syncer, not coming from. |
| const std::string& GetTag() const; |
| }; |
| |
| // A SyncData that comes from the syncer. |
| class SyncDataRemote : public SyncData { |
| public: |
| // Construct a SyncDataRemote from a SyncData. |
| // |
| // |sync_data|'s IsLocal() must be false. |
| explicit SyncDataRemote(const SyncData& sync_data); |
| ~SyncDataRemote(); |
| |
| // Returns the tag hash value. May not always be present, in which case an |
| // empty string will be returned. |
| const std::string& GetClientTagHash() const; |
| |
| // Deprecated: might not be populated in SyncableService API. |
| // TODO(crbug.com/870624): Remove when directory is removed. |
| int64_t GetId() const; |
| }; |
| |
| // gmock printer helper. |
| void PrintTo(const SyncData& sync_data, std::ostream* os); |
| |
| using SyncDataList = std::vector<SyncData>; |
| |
| } // namespace syncer |
